Releasing Bolsonaro would demoralize the STF, says Lula in an interview in Bahia

President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va (PT) stated this Friday (6) that overturning the veto on the dosimetry project would be a demoralization of the Federal Supreme Court (STF), which tried and condemned people for the coup acts of January 8, 2023. Without directly mentioning former president Jair Bolsonaro (PL), one of the beneficiaries of the project, Lula said that an amnesty should be made after years.

“This citizen has to stay in prison. Then one fine day, there might be an amnesty for him, like there was in 1964, ten or 15 years later. You can’t play at trying to judge. If you release him, you demoralize the seriousness of the Supreme Court that condemned him”, he declared during an interview with the program “Alô, Juca”, on TV Aratu. Lula has a schedule in Bahia this Friday.

Lula also said he had done his part and that an eventual overturning of the veto would be “a problem for Congress”. “It’s the problem of the National Congress. I did my part. Congress made the law, approved it. I know the conditions that were discussed. I did my part, I vetoed it because I don’t agree. This citizen has to be arrested”, he said.

Still without mentioning Bolsonaro directly, the PT member compared the former president to a “mad dog”: “Do you think that if you have a mad dog in prison and you release him, he will be more tame? This citizen tried to destroy Brazilian democracy. This citizen, who was sentenced to 27 years and 3 months in prison, had a plan to kill Lula, Alckmin and Alexandre Moraes”, added the president.
